Military medical professionals tested in capstone Joint Emergency Medicine Exercise

Summary by DVIDS
The annual Joint Emergency Medicine Exercise concluded June 5 at Fort Hood. Hosted by Carl R. Darnall Army Medical Center, the large-scale, multi-service combat casualty care exercise trains and validates the skills of graduating residents from Army, Navy, and Air Force medical programs, combat medics, and international medical allies and partners.
